SANDRA ROGERS

Picture
 - July 2015 
​

"I only started after retiring from the rat race, and I found it amazing to sit down and paint for three hours and realise that I had become so totally absorbed in the work that my mind was released from all the noise and chatter of day-to-day life."

Sandra spent 2 years doing water colours in Johannesburg before moving on to oils whilst living in Botswana for 3 years. She tried acrylics just prior to returning to Canada and continued with acrylics since  introduced to Golden products. Sandra leaned towards impressionism
